Output 104e675326b58cd3ca225d1f18eb6c85527b320a8ca80ef2fbc7d2dfc52ae1f6:4

value
2450577
script pubkey
OP_0 OP_PUSHBYTES_20 7d25afe00a23047d1a19bdd252e73e9eaac3b715
address
bc1q05j6lcq2yvz86xsehhf99ee7n64v8dc4jqf3gy
transaction
104e675326b58cd3ca225d1f18eb6c85527b320a8ca80ef2fbc7d2dfc52ae1f6
spent
true